Output 616ab62279ae8e8c222f03fcae7821d84bbec87e2206f7ff4cfe7e63eb7804e4:0

value
18833253
script pubkey
OP_0 OP_PUSHBYTES_20 c3cc8be44d95c8619e464daa2e2e356f149b18fe
address
ltc1qc0xghezdjhyxr8jxfk4zut34du2fkx87ej5ywm
transaction
616ab62279ae8e8c222f03fcae7821d84bbec87e2206f7ff4cfe7e63eb7804e4
spent
true